Why Real-Time Adjustments Matter in Delivery Logistics

Real-time adjustments in delivery logistics refer to the ability to modify plans, routes, and schedules to respond to immediate challenges and opportunities during the delivery process. Ensuring these adjustments are effectively implemented can lead to several significant benefits:

Enhanced Customer Satisfaction

  • Immediate Feedback: Quick adjustments enable companies to respond to customer feedback or changes in demand, making it easier to meet expectations.
  • Accuracy: Accurate delivery tracking reduces the number of missed deliveries, thereby boosting customer trust.
  • Increased Operational Efficiency

  • Dynamic Route Planning: Real-time adjustments allow logistics managers to plan routes dynamically. By utilizing route optimization tools, businesses can save time and fuel, ultimately reducing costs.
  • Resource Allocation: Adjustments can help logistics companies allocate resources more effectively during peak times. This ensures that deliveries are met without overextending operations.
  • How to Implement Real-Time Adjustments in Delivery Logistics

    Implementing real-time adjustments involves a systematic approach that incorporates technology and effective management strategies.

    Step 1: Utilize Advanced Tracking Technologies

    Investing in advanced tracking technologies is essential for effective delivery management. Solutions like CIGO Tracker can provide real-time data on delivery statuses, vehicle locations, and potential delays. Enhanced tracking allows for timely adjustments to delivery routes or schedules.

    Step 2: Train Your Team for Responsiveness

    Having a responsive team is crucial for implementing real-time adjustments. Training employees to handle unexpected changes effectively ensures that your logistics operations remain agile.

    Step 3: Monitor External Factors

    Keep an eye on factors that could affect delivery logistics, such as:

  • Traffic Conditions: Real-time traffic data can inform route changes.
  • Weather Impacts: Monitoring weather forecasts helps in planning adjustments ahead of time.
  • Using reliable data sources enhances the ability of teams to make informed decisions rapidly.

Challenges in Implementation

While implementing real-time adjustments can yield significant benefits, various challenges can arise:

Technology Costs

Investing in the infrastructure to enable real-time tracking and adjustments can be daunting for some logistics companies. However, the long-term savings and efficiency often outweigh initial costs.

Data Management

Handling large amounts of data requires appropriate systems and processes. Companies must ensure they have the right tools to analyze and act on the data gathered.

Resistance to Change

Employees may resist adopting new technologies and processes. To combat this, it’s crucial to foster an organizational culture that embraces change and innovation.

FAQs About Real-Time Adjustments in Delivery Logistics

What are real-time adjustments in delivery logistics?

Real-time adjustments in delivery logistics refer to the process of adapting delivery routes, schedules, and resources in response to immediate operational challenges.

How do real-time adjustments improve delivery efficiency?

By enabling companies to respond quickly to changes, such as traffic or customer requests, real-time adjustments can enhance operational efficiency and reduce costs.

What technologies are essential for facilitating real-time adjustments?

Technologies such as GPS tracking, advanced route planning tools, and data analysis software are essential for enabling effective real-time adjustments in logistics.

What are the key factors that influence responsiveness in delivery logistics?
